Understanding Home Improvement

Home improvement incorporates a vast array of jobs focused on upgrading, repairing, or improving the performance of a home. From small repairs to significant restorations, the scope of home improvement can vary greatly depending on private requirements and budget plans.

Kinds Of Home Improvement Projects

Home improvement tasks can be broadly categorized into the list below types:

TypeDescriptionExamples
Cosmetic UpgradesEnhancements that improve aesthetics without structural changes.Painting, landscaping, brand-new floor covering
Structural ChangesAdjustments that modify the physical structure of the home.Adding a space, removing walls
Energy EfficiencyImprovements that boost the energy performance of the home.Setting up insulation, energy-efficient windows
MaintenanceRoutine maintenance to guarantee the home remains in good condition.Roof repairs, plumbing repairs
Smart Home UpgradesInstallation of clever technologies for improved living.Smart thermostats, security systems

Each category serves distinct purposes, and homeowners need to evaluate their needs and spending plan before starting a task.

Planning Your Home Improvement Project

Appropriate planning is vital to the success of any home improvement project. Here are steps to think about:

Step 1: Define Your Goals

Determine what aspects of your home need improvement. Are you seeking to increase convenience, improve aesthetics, or improve energy performance?

Action 2: Set a Budget

Develop a clear budget that accounts for products, labor, and unforeseen costs. It's advisable to allocate 10-20% of your spending plan for contingencies.

Step 3: Research and Gather Inspiration

Search for motivation online, in magazines, and through home improvement shows. Platforms like Pinterest and Instagram can provide a wealth of ideas.

Step 4: Develop a Timeline

Creating a timeline allows you to set practical expectations regarding job completion. Consider the scope of work and potential hold-ups.

Step 5: Hire Professionals or DIY?

Choose whether to take on the task yourself or work with specialists. For complex tasks, employing experts can conserve time and guarantee quality work.

Several home improvement tasks are favored by homeowners for their potential return on investment (ROI) and enhancement of living conditions. Here's a list of popular projects:

Kitchen Remodeling

  • Updating countertops, cabinets, and appliances.
  • ROI: Typically around 70-80%.

Bathroom Renovation

  • Installing new components, tiles, and lighting.
  • ROI: A well-executed bathroom remodel can yield 60-70%.

Landscaping

  • Enhancing curb appeal through planting and hardscaping.
  • ROI: Landscaping can return around 100% on investment.

Energy-Efficient Windows

  • Installing double or triple-pane windows to reduce energy costs.
  • ROI: Can yield around 70-80%.

Interior Painting

  • A fresh coat of paint can transform any area.
  • ROI: High return with very little financial investment.
Home Improvement ProjectApproximated ROI (%)Approximate Cost
Kitchen Remodeling70-80₤ 20,000 - ₤ 60,000
Bathroom Renovation60-70₤ 10,000 - ₤ 30,000
Landscaping100₤ 5,000 - ₤ 15,000
Energy-Efficient Windows70-80₤ 10,000 - ₤ 15,000
Interior Painting75-100₤ 1,500 - ₤ 5,000
